Norwich's Brevin Bennett finishes 14th at the NYSPHSAA golf championship

Congratulations to Norwich’s Brevin Bennett and Coach Dave Branham on a good run at the NYSPHSAA golf championship. Bennett finished tied for 14th and received All-State honors. (Photo from Norwich Athletics)

CHURCHVILLE—Norwich eighth grader Brevin Bennett competed in the 2026 NYSPHSAA golf championship over the weekend, where he finished 14th overall.

Bennett tied for ninth after the first round, where he shot a even 71.

"Brevin played very well and fought hard for the even score," Coach Dave Branham said. "Brevin's greatest assets is his chipping and putting undoubtedly.

"He also keeps the ball and play very well. We often talk about keeping the golf ball between the green and yourself, which means pretty much down the middle. Brevin rarely vists the ruff or the sides of the golf course."

Bennett and Branham were both excited for the final round on Monday, where the weather was beautiful and Bennett played with a great group.

Bennett finished the final round tied for 14th place, where he shot a +5 and earned All-State honors.

“Brevin had a great experience at the New York State boys golf championship. He definitely fits in very well and will possibly be an eventual champion I believe,” Branham said. “His strengths are keeping the ball and play and minimizing his mistakes. Also a very big one is his stamina. It was a very hot long two days. Total golf time for two days was 11 1/2 hours. I would say a lot of standing and walking. When many players were beginning to wilt and make mistakes because they were retired Brevin seem to get stronger. I truly believe that’s attributed to his massive amount of golf. He plays at the country club and other tournaments. Brevin and I made a lot of new friends which will be with us for the rest of our lives and we really look forward to doing this again next year because I’m positive we will be back.”
